Handy information about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port (TNG)
When it comes to the on-time performance of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port, data shows 70.14% of flights complete their journey on time.
Central Tangier to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port is around 10 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 20 minutes to get there if you're catching a cab, ride-sharing or driving.
Planning to take public transport? Expect a journey time of around 1 hour.

Getting from Helsinki-Vantaa Airport (HEL) to central Helsinki
Helsinki-Vantaa Airport is roughly 19 kilometres from central Helsinki. The drive time takes around 30 minutes.
Getting there by public transport typically takes 45 minutes.
When to fly to Helsinki-Vantaa Airport (HEL)
It's time to pick your dates for your flight from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port to Helsinki-Vantaa Airport. June is the busiest month to visit Helsinki. If you prefer a more relaxed vibe, go in February.
Lock in your flight from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port to Helsinki-Vantaa Airport for July if you want to go to Helsinki during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ures of between 12ºC and 26ºC.
Look for cheap tickets from TNG to HEL in January if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-12ºC and 3ºC on average.
